首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在python_中读取TDMS文件如何使用tdmsinfo命令?

在Python中读取TDMS文件可以使用nptdms库来实现,该库提供了一种方便的方式来读取和处理TDMS文件。要使用tdmsinfo命令,需要先安装nptdms库。

以下是使用tdmsinfo命令读取TDMS文件的步骤:

  1. 安装nptdms库。可以使用以下命令通过pip安装:
代码语言:txt
复制

pip install nptdms

代码语言:txt
复制
  1. 导入nptdms库:
代码语言:python
代码运行次数:0
复制

import nptdms

代码语言:txt
复制
  1. 使用nptdms库的TdmsFile类打开TDMS文件:
代码语言:python
代码运行次数:0
复制

tdms_file = nptdms.TdmsFile.read("path/to/tdms/file.tdms")

代码语言:txt
复制

这将读取指定路径下的TDMS文件并将其存储在tdms_file对象中。

  1. 使用tdmsinfo命令获取TDMS文件的信息:
代码语言:python
代码运行次数:0
复制

tdms_info = tdms_file.object().tdmsinfo

代码语言:txt
复制

这将返回一个包含TDMS文件信息的对象,可以通过该对象访问TDMS文件的各种属性和元数据。

例如,可以使用以下代码打印TDMS文件的通道信息:

代码语言:python
代码运行次数:0
复制

for group in tdms_info.groups():

代码语言:txt
复制
   for channel in group.channels():
代码语言:txt
复制
       print("Group: {}, Channel: {}".format(group.name, channel.name))
代码语言:txt
复制

这将遍历所有的组和通道,并打印它们的名称。

需要注意的是,tdmsinfo命令是nptdms库中的一个属性,用于获取TDMS文件的信息。在使用tdmsinfo命令之前,需要先导入nptdms库并读取TDMS文件。

关于TDMS文件的更多信息和使用方法,可以参考腾讯云的相关产品介绍链接:TDMS文件读取与处理

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券